前不論安卓陣營還是IOS陣營,系統懸浮球已經是一個隨意可見的功能了,不論系統定制的,還是第三方App度可以滿足大家的需求,各個系統的懸浮球的差別就不一一列舉了,用過的小伙伴自然是心中有數的呀!
相信大家都知道蘋果在iOS 5推出了懸浮球的功能,其實小米在MIUI8的時候也推出了懸浮球的功能,但是你真的會用它嗎?如果你覺得自己對MIUI懸浮球功能知之甚少,那么請跟隨先生的腳步,詳細的了解一下MIUI的懸浮球功能。
一、開啟方法
MIUI懸浮球的開啟方法是在系統設置-更多設置里面找到懸浮球,點擊進入后打開懸浮球就可以。當然大家比較懶的話也可以在下拉通知欄搜索“懸浮球”,同樣是點擊進入后打開懸浮球就可以。就是這么簡單。
二、功能詳解
1、自定義菜單
MIUI的懸浮球一共可以放置5種不同的功能,其中每個功能都可以設置為更改系統設置、打開快捷功能、快捷支付或打開預先設置好的應用。具體可以打開的操作如圖
我在這里舉個栗子:小明牽著女朋友在街上閑逛,突然小明的小米max2從褲兜滑了出來摔在地上,碰巧把手機下方的返回鍵摔壞了,這個時候小明就機智的呼出了MIUI懸浮球并將返回鍵設置在菜單里面,這樣子小明的小米max2又復活啦。
2、操作模式
MIUI的懸浮球專門為大家設置了兩種操作模式“點擊、滑動”
所謂點擊,就是在打開懸浮球后,點擊相關的選項后就可以了。而滑動,則是呼出懸浮球之后,從懸浮球滑向相關的選項就可以。
3、隱藏懸浮球
顧名思義,隱藏懸浮球就是在選定的應用界面里面不顯示懸浮球,這種選項一般在玩游戲的時候使用,用來防止誤觸到懸浮球。
4、全屏下自動貼邊
這個功能和“隱藏懸浮球”一樣,都是為了在全屏游戲時候防止誤觸用的。
還是請出我們的小明同學。小明同學平時喜歡用小米max2打王者榮耀,一天他剛剛開了一把排位,由于沒有把懸浮球貼邊,團戰的時候老是誤點到懸浮球,導致被團滅,最后排位輸了。(手動滑稽)
5、在鎖屏界面顯示
這個選項也挺好理解,就是說在鎖屏界面中也顯示懸浮窗,可以建議返回鍵摔壞的小明同學開啟這個選項。
文末語:MIUI的懸浮球對于iOS的懸浮球來說雖說推出的時間較晚,可是在功能和特性(可隱藏懸浮球、可自動貼邊等等)上比iOS的懸浮球多了不少,可以算得上是后來居上了吧。文章里面的只是我個人對于懸浮球玩法的理解,如果大家有更好玩的玩法,歡迎補充。
更多玩機技巧、還有相關問題可以來MIUI論壇APP——問答專區進行了解!
這里是陳先生雜談,歡迎大家關注!本文系引用,部分有刪改,僅為分享、交流、傳播信息所用,版權歸MIUI論壇帥比徐凱所有,本人不承擔任何法律責任,詳細參考:http://www.miui.com/thread-8913380-1-1.html
分享的這款工具是個Chrome下的插件,叫:Web Scraper,是一款可以從網頁中提取數據的Chrome網頁數據提取插件。在某種意義上,你也可以把它當做一個爬蟲工具。
也是因為最近在梳理36氪文章一些標簽,打算看下別家和創投相關的網站有什么標準可以參考,于是發現一家名叫:“烯牛數據”的網站,其提供的一套“行業體系”標簽很有參考價值,就說想把頁面上的數據抓下來,整合到我們自己的標簽庫中,如下圖紅字部分:
如果是規則展示的數據,還能用鼠標選擇后復制粘貼,但這種嵌入頁面中的,還是要想些辦法。這時想起之前安裝過Web Scraper,就用下試試,還挺好用的,一下子提高了收集效率。也給大家安利下~
Web Scraper這個Chrome插件,我是一年前在三節課的公開課上看到的,號稱不用懂編程也能實現爬蟲抓取的黑科技,不過貌似三節課官網上找不到了,大家可以百度:“三節課 爬蟲”,還能搜到,名字叫“人人都能學會的數據爬蟲課”,但好像還要交100塊錢。我是覺得這東西看看網上的文章也能學會,比如我這篇~
簡單來說,Web Scraper是個基于Chrome的網頁元素解析器,可以通過可視化點選操作,實現某個定制區域的數據/元素提取。同時它也提供定時自動提取功能,活用這個功能就可以當做一套簡單的爬蟲工具來用了。
這里再順便解釋下網頁提取器抓取和真正代碼編寫爬蟲的區別,用網頁提取器自動提取頁面數據的過程,有點類似模擬人工點擊的機器人,它是先讓你定義好頁面上要抓哪個元素,以及要抓哪些頁面,然后讓機器去替人來操作;而如果你用Python寫爬蟲,更多是利用網頁請求指令先把整個網頁下載下來,再用代碼去解析HTML頁面元素,提取其中你想要的內容,再不斷循環。相比而言,用代碼會更靈活,但解析成本也會更高,如果是簡單的頁面內容提取,我也是建議用Web Scraper就夠了。
關于Web Scraper的具體安裝過程,以及完整功能的使用方法,我不會在今天的文章里展開說。第一是我只使用了我需要的部分,第二也是因為市面上講Web Scraper的教程很豐富,大家完全可以自行查找。
這里只以一個實操過程,給大家簡單介紹下我是怎么用的。
第一步 創建Sitemap
打開Chrome瀏覽器,按F12調出開發者工具,Web Scraper在最后一個頁簽,點擊后,再選擇“Create Sitemap”菜單,點擊“Create Sitemap”選項。
首先輸入你想抓取的網站URL,以及你自定義的這條抓取任務的名字,比如我取的name是:xiniulevel,URL是:http://www.xiniudata.com/industry/level
第二步 創建抓取節點
我想抓取的是一級標簽和二級標簽,所以先點進去剛才創建的Sitemap,再點擊“Add new selector”,進入抓取節點選擇器配置頁,在頁面上點擊“Select”按鈕,這時你會看到出現了一個浮層
這時當你鼠標移入網頁時,會自動把某個你鼠標懸停的位置綠色高亮。這時你可以先單擊一個你想選擇的區塊,會發現區塊變成了紅色,想把同一層級的區塊全選中,則可以繼續點擊相鄰的下一個區塊,這時工具會默認選中所有同級的區塊,如下圖:
我們會發現下方懸浮窗的文本輸入框自動填充了區塊的XPATH路徑,接著點擊“Done selecting!”結束選擇,懸浮框消失,選中的XPATH自動填充到下方Selector一行。另外務必選中“Multiple”,以聲明你要選多個區塊。最后點擊Save selector按鈕結束。
第三步 獲取元素值
完成Selector的創建后,回到上一頁,你會發現多了一行Selector表格,接下來就可以直接點擊Action中的Data preview,查看所有想獲取的元素值。
上圖所示部分,是我已經添加了一級標簽和二級標簽兩個Selector的情況,點擊Data preview的彈窗內容其實就是我想要的,直接復制到EXCEL就行了,也不用什么太復雜的自動化爬取處理。
以上就是對Web Scraper使用過程的簡單介紹。當然我的用法還不是完全高效,因為每次想獲取二級標簽時還要先手動切換一級標簽,再執行抓取指令,應該還有更好的做法,不過對我而言已經足夠了。這篇文章主要是想和你普及下這款工具,不算教程,更多功能還是要根據你的需求自行摸索~
怎么樣,是否有幫到你?期待你的留言與我分享~
TML 的 onmouseover 事件是網頁開發人員工具箱中一個強大的工具。通過本文,你將全面掌握 onmouseover 事件的使用方法,并了解如何創建充滿活力和互動的網頁元素。從基本原理到高級應用,我們將探索 onmouseover 事件的各種可能性。
onmouseover 事件揭秘
onmouseover 事件在鼠標指針移動到特定元素上方時觸發。這為網頁開發人員提供了捕捉用戶互動并相應地改變網頁元素的機會。該事件通常與 onmouseout 事件搭配使用,后者在鼠標指針移出元素時觸發。
基本語法
onmouseover="代碼"
在這里,"代碼" 是指當鼠標懸停在元素上時你希望執行的 JavaScript 代碼。讓我們看一個簡單的例子:
<div onmouseover="alert('你好,世界!')">懸停我</div>
在這個例子中,當用戶將鼠標懸停在 "懸停我" 元素上時,它會彈出一個帶有 "你好,世界!" 消息的警示框。
動態效果和樣式更改
onmouseover 事件真正閃光的地方在于它可以改變網頁元素的樣式和外觀。你可以改變元素的背景顏色、邊框、字體大小等。來看一個例子:
<style>
.box {
width: 100px;
height: 100px;
background-color: lightgray;
}
</style>
<div class="box" onmouseover="this.style.backgroundColor='red'">
將鼠標懸停于此
</div>
在這個例子中,當鼠標懸停在方塊上時,它的背景顏色會變成紅色。
圖像效果
onmouseover 事件在圖像上也很有用。你可以創建圖像懸停效果,為你的網頁增添視覺吸引力。來看一個例子:
<img src="image1.jpg" onmouseover="this.src='image2.jpg'">
在這個例子中,當鼠標懸停在圖像上時,圖像會切換為 "image2.jpg"。
菜單和下拉列表
onmouseover 事件在創建菜單和下拉列表時也很有用。你可以顯示隱藏的菜單項或下拉列表,為用戶提供動態的導航體驗。
<div onmouseover="document.getElementById('menu').style.display='block'">
顯示菜單
</div>
<div id="menu" style="display: none;">
<a href="#">鏈接 1</a>
<a href="#">鏈接 2</a>
<a href="#">鏈接 3</a>
</div>
結論:釋放你的創造力
onmouseover 事件為網頁開發人員提供了增強用戶體驗和創建動態交互的機會。從簡單的樣式更改到復雜的菜單系統,onmouseover 事件都可以勝任。通過本文的學習,你已經掌握了 onmouseover 事件的基本原理和應用。現在,你可以利用這些知識,在你的網頁設計中加入生動的元素,創造出引人入勝的用戶體驗!釋放你的創造力,讓網頁更加充滿活力!
*請認真填寫需求信息,我們會在24小時內與您取得聯系。